The Rigol DG822 is a dual-channel function and arbitrary waveform generator operating to 25 MHz, engineered for education, research, and industrial test applications. It combines SiFi II technology for point-by-point arbitrary waveform generation with a responsive 4.3-inch touchscreen interface and fanless operation. The instrument delivers 16-bit vertical resolution, 125 MSa/s sample rate, and standard memory depth of 2 Mpts (upgradeable to 8 Mpts), with frequency stability of ±1 ppm and phase noise of -105 dBc/Hz.
– Technical Specifications
Waveform Generation:
• Frequency range: DC to 25 MHz
• Channels: 2
• Arbitrary waveform memory: 2 Mpts (standard), 8 Mpts (optional)
• Sample rate: 125 MSa/s
• Vertical resolution: 16 bits
• Frequency stability: ±1 ppm
• Phase noise: -105 dBc/Hz
• Jitter: 200 ps (rms)
Waveform Library:
• Standard waveforms: Sine, Square, Ramp, Pulse, Noise, Harmonic, DC, Dual-tone
• Built-in arbitrary waveforms: 160 types
• Harmonic generator: up to 8th order
• Pulse edge time: 3 ns rise time at 25 MHz
• Square wave output: 40 MHz
• Arbitrary waveform sequencing: up to 64 events with 256 repetitions
Modulation:
• Analog: AM, FM, PM
• Digital: ASK, FSK, PSK, PWM
• SUM modulation supported
Output:
• Amplitude range: 1 mVpp to 10 Vpp
• Output impedance: 50 Ω
• Output into 50 Ω: 1.0 mVpp to 10 Vpp (DC–10 MHz), 5 Vpp (25 MHz)
Frequency Counter:
• Measurement bandwidth: 240 MHz
• Resolution: 7 digits/second
• Parameters: Frequency, period, duty cycle, positive and negative pulse width
Physical and Electrical:
• Display: 4.3-inch TFT color touchscreen
• Interfaces: USB Host/Device, LAN, Web Control
• Power input: USB Type-C
• Dimensions: 266 mm (W) × 165 mm (H) × 80 mm (D)
• Weight: 1.78 kg
• Cooling: Fanless design
– Key Features
• SiFi II point-by-point arbitrary waveform generation minimizes distortion
• Touch-enabled interface with tap and drag gesture support
• Dual-channel independent or synchronized operation
• Optional memory expansion to 8 Mpts for extended waveform complexity
– Typical Applications
• Educational lab demonstrations and student experiments
• Circuit design verification and prototype testing
• Signal conditioning and source simulation
• Industrial equipment commissioning and maintenance
– Compatibility & Integration
• USB Host/Device connectivity for control and data transfer
• Ethernet (LAN) and web-based control interface
• Optional USB-GPIB interface converter for legacy system integration
• Optional 40 dB attenuator for amplitude control
